    so true about the "deeply discounted" items - bought a few things on extreme sale from fast fashion places in the past, and every single time i instantly understood why it was reduced so much. either the fabric, fit, or something was always totally off and unwearable. makes me think it's probably cheaper for them to sell it to you for 2 bucks than to dump it themselves.
